Meet Copal

copal is a super special dog and i am going to be super picky on who adopts him. copal is a super big standard Mexican hairless/xolo he is about 6 years old and weighs in at about 70+ pounds. i have never seen a xolo nearly as big as he is. he is a very nice dog, he loves people and gets along with most other dogs, he can be a little bossy sometimes, but he is not an alpha male, just a boy with occasional bad manners, but he is very correctable. he is good in the house and is crate trained. he is fully vetted, neutered, has all of his shots and is on heart-worm prevention. his skin is healthy, but he has an occasional flair up of itchy patches and is prone to the weird xolo black head thing, but over all his skin is beautiful. i adore this dog, and it is hard to let him go, but we can not offer what a private home can, and i want him to be adored. if you think you are a super above average home, and are interested in adopting copal, please tell us about yourself and your household. he will need to be picked up here in tennessee, and if you are out of state, we will have to arrange for a home visit, by a local rescue, no exceptions. his adoption fee is $600, which will go to fund the less adoptable dogs that in some cases never get adopted. thanks.
